4.0 out of 5 stars Does the job, again and again., May 23, 2011
By 
As a bigger runner (6'4", 215), I first tried other shoes-got a sore knee-and hit up my local expert running shop. Said shop determined I required a shoe with neutral support and put me on a treadmill to tape my stride. I am currently on my second pair of D-3s (traded the first out after 300 miles) and would strongly suggest trading them out maybe around 250 miles. I'm far from the most graceful runner, but the D-3 really gave me the support and cushioning required to keep me moving. As I utilize Nike's nikeplus system but aren't able to get the support from Nike's shoes, I simply purchased The Original Shoe Pouch for Nike + iPod, Assorted Colors for the transmitter and have experienced no issues. My feet tend to be on the narrow side and my arch is slightly higher than average. Great enough shoes that I have three waiting in the closet for when I'm done with my current pair. I knocked the score down one star because I hoped I could get more than 300 out of them. Each week sees me running about 20-30 miles.

5.0 out of 5 stars Great shoe!, March 16, 2011
This was my first running shoe. I am a "light" runner, as far as footfalls go. I am 5'9" and weight 165lbs. I have low arches and my left leg is a quarter inch shorter than my right, but with some orthotic insoles these shoes allowed me to run in immense comfort for 367.07 miles. They did not fall apart and the sole wasn't even worn looking, even after the cushioning had gone for me.
They have a great fitting toebox, not too loose, and they held the heel of my foot firmly in place. The heel of the shoe is quite padded and fairly far off the ground, but that's okay by me. They still felt stable and I always felt as though I had good traction when running in them.
All in all they were almost perfect shoes in my book.
